    Remarks

    A110-1 FOR CD CTC PORTLAND APCH AT 503-493-7545.
    A110-2 LND USING RIGHT TFC ON BOTH RWYS. DPT USING LEFT TFC OR SLGT LEFT TURN FOR NOISE REDCUTION. BOTH RWYS CLIMB TO FULL PAT ALT BFR OVERFLYING ADJ HOMES ON RIDGES ON BOTH SIDES OF RWYS. LND AT YOUR OWN RISK. LMT NOISY OPS. LMT REPETITIVE PRACTICE.
